Ji Chang-wook of upcoming film “Fabricated City” spoke about moments he felt cathartic in an interview with fashion magazine Marie Claire’s February issue.

The 29-year-old said that as an actor he has his due moments of frustration and agony, but he feels cathartic when he is able to find the right rhythm of flow with other actors on the stage.

“I put in my sincere feelings when I act,” Ji told the magazine.

“Fabricated City” will release in February. Ji plays the main character who is an online game enthusiast wrongly framed of murder.

Ji’s full interview is available in the February issue of Marie Claire.
